Understanding the Evergreen Webinar Challenge

An evergreen webinar is designed to work on autopilot. Once it’s set up, the content can continuously attract new leads, educate your audience, and convert prospects without the need for constant live sessions. Despite the appeal of this strategy, many businesses find that their evergreen webinars fail to deliver the expected results. One major reason is poor branding, which can render even the most insightful content ineffective.

When your branding does not resonate with your target audience or fails to communicate your unique value proposition, it becomes incredibly challenging to stand out in a crowded marketplace. As a result, even if your evergreen webinars are packed with useful information, the lack of a compelling brand narrative may lead to underwhelming engagement and low conversion rates.

Key Branding Issues Impacting Evergreen Webinars

Some frequent branding pitfalls include:

  • Inconsistent Visual Identity: Mismatched colors, fonts, and logos can dilute your brand’s presence and cause confusion.
  • Unclear Messaging: If your value proposition is not communicated effectively, viewers may not understand why your content matters.
  • Lack of Authenticity: A generic, impersonal presentation can leave your audience feeling disconnected and less likely to engage.
  • Over-Reliance on Automation: While evergreen webinars run automatically, they must still reflect the passion and authenticity that live presentations offer.

By addressing these challenges through a well-thought-out branding strategy, you can transform your evergreen webinar into a powerful tool for growth.

Strategies for Better Branding in Evergreen Webinars

To turn your underperforming evergreen webinar into a conversion powerhouse, consider implementing the following strategies:

Define and Refine Your Brand Identity

A strong brand identity is foundational to effective marketing. Begin by revisiting your brand’s mission, values, and unique selling points. Ask yourself:

  • What problem do we solve?
  • Who is our ideal customer?
  • What tone do we want to strike: friendly, professional, or perhaps even a bit quirky?

Once you have clarity, translate these values into every aspect of your webinar— from the visuals and slides to the script itself.

Invest in High-Quality Visuals

Visual elements are an integral part of the branding process. Invest in professional graphic design to ensure that your webinar’s look is modern, clean, and memorable. Consistency is key:

  • Uniform Color Schemes: Use a cohesive color palette that aligns with your overall brand identity.
  • Consistent Fonts and Layouts: Ensure your text and slide designs are consistent throughout the presentation.
  • Engaging Visuals: Incorporate high-quality images, infographics, and animations to keep the audience engaged.

Craft a Compelling Story

Rather than merely presenting data, use storytelling to breathe life into your content. A well-told story can help illustrate the benefits of your product or service and show how it solves real-world problems. Consider integrating case studies or testimonials from satisfied customers to build credibility and appeal.

Here are some storytelling best practices:

  • Start with a Hook: Grab your viewers’ attention in the first few seconds.
  • Structure Your Narrative: Clearly outline the problem, the solution, and the outcomes.
  • Include Real-Life Examples: Use case studies to show tangible benefits and results.
  • Maintain Authenticity: Ensure your narrative reflects your true brand values.

Leverage Interactive Elements

Integrating interactive elements into your evergreen webinar can make it feel more dynamic and personalized, even when automated. Consider incorporating these enhancements:

  • Polls and Surveys: Use these to gather feedback and adjust your content dynamically.
  • Q&A Sessions: Pre-record and integrate common questions, or include segments where viewers can send in questions via chat.
  • Interactive Slides: Utilize clickable elements that allow viewers to dive deeper into topics of interest.

Optimize Your Content for Different Platforms

Modern audiences access content on various devices and platforms. A well-branded evergreen webinar should be optimized for multiple channels, ensuring a seamless experience whether it’s viewed on a desktop, tablet, or smartphone.

  • Responsive Design: Ensure that your webinar is mobile-friendly.
  • Multiple Formats: Consider offering your webinar as both a video and as a series of shorter, digestible segments.
  • Integration with Social Media: Optimize snippets or highlights for social media sharing to drive broader engagement.

Monitor, Analyze, and Iterate

Continuous improvement is key to long-term success. The performance of an evergreen webinar can be significantly enhanced by meticulously tracking its success and iterating based on data-driven insights.

  • Set Clear KPIs: Determine which metrics (e.g., registration rate, engagement rate, conversion rate) are most important to your business.
  • Regular Audits: Conduct periodic reviews of your webinar content and branding elements.
  • Incorporate Feedback: Listen to your audience and make necessary adjustments to enhance their experience.

Case Study: Transforming an Evergreen Webinar Through Branding

Consider the case of a mid-sized tech company that struggled to engage its audience through automated webinars. Despite having informative content, their evergreen webinars were underperforming. After a brand refresh and a strategic overhaul of their webinar content, the company experienced significant improvements. Here’s what they did:

  1. Overhauled Visual Identity: The company invested in high-quality graphics, new slide templates, and an updated color palette that matched its renewed mission. This not only made the webinar more visually appealing but also reinforced brand consistency.
  2. Refined Messaging: They rewrote their scripts to ensure that every segment of the webinar communicated clear, actionable benefits for the audience. They emphasized storytelling over facts and figures to make the content more relatable.
  3. Incorporated Interactive Elements: By introducing live polls and Q&A sessions—even in a recorded format—the company was able to mimic the interactivity of live webinars, which helped maintain viewer interest and engagement.
  4. Focused on Continuous Improvement: The company established a feedback loop where viewer responses were analyzed to identify areas for improvement. This iterative approach ensured that the evergreen webinar evolved continuously to meet audience needs.

The results were profound: increased viewer retention, higher registration rates, and ultimately, a better conversion rate. This case study exemplifies how robust branding can address the common pitfalls associated with evergreen webinars.
